Output 3f0e3d3dc5a01b1e654b40f381fef181d966039cf54023c4ea73578e148f31da:2

value
8569738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bba98e5c04a9c6ec6e4201179de532db6ded852 OP_EQUAL
address
3BWdm5FxUVc8vLnApiDSqhuYP3amVAqrwb
transaction
3f0e3d3dc5a01b1e654b40f381fef181d966039cf54023c4ea73578e148f31da
spent
true